    What is Dr. Brian Schroer's specialty?

    Dr. Schroer is a Pediatric Allergist & Immunologist near Cleveland, OH. A Pediatric Allergist & Immunologist is a physician who specializes in diagnosing and treating allergies, asthma, and immune system disorders in infants, children, and adolescents. These specialists address conditions such as food allergies, eczema, hay fever, allergic reactions, primary immunodeficiencies, and autoimmune diseases, providing comprehensive care tailored to the unique needs of younger patients.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ise.
